How they compare
Liberia currently reports 22.63 million against 21.18 million in Suriname, a difference of 1.45 million.
That makes Liberia's figure about 1.1 times Suriname's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Liberia ahead.
Liberia ranks 130th and Suriname ranks 133rd of 221 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Liberia averaged higher in 1 and Suriname in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Liberia | Suriname |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 8.24 million | 11.01 million | 2.77 million | Suriname |
| 2010s | 16.25 million | 18.15 million | 1.89 million | Suriname |
| 2020s | 22.05 million | 20.50 million | 1.55 million | Liberia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
